What We Offer: A Personalized, Multidisciplinary Approach

Every child is different, and so is every care plan. Our program is built around the idea that effective support must be tailored to the unique needs of your child and your family.

Whole-Child Evaluations

During the first visit, we assess for any underlying medical issues that may be contributing to weight gain. We also take a close look at how your child’s weight may be affecting their health, growth, and emotional well-being. If needed, we coordinate care with pediatric specialists to ensure nothing is overlooked.

Lifestyle Counseling

We help children and families build sustainable habits from understanding nutrition and meal planning to navigating emotional triggers around food. Our sessions focus on portion sizes, balanced meals, and the social factors that often affect how children eat.

Medical Weight Management

In some cases, lifestyle changes alone may not be enough. When appropriate, we offer FDA-approved medications for adolescent weight loss as part of a comprehensive plan to support healthier outcomes.

Adolescent Bariatric Surgery

At K. Hovnanian Children’s Hospital and Joseph M. Sanzari Children's Hospital, we offer adolescent bariatric surgery through an accredited program in New Jersey. This option is considered for eligible patients after careful evaluation, and it always includes emotional support and continued lifestyle guidance before and after surgery.

Throughout the process, families are met with understanding, not judgment. Our care team, including pediatricians, nutritionists, behavioral health specialists, social workers, and bariatric surgeons, works together to support your child’s physical and emotional health.
